Understanding the Context
The word magnanimous comes from the Latin magnanimus, meaning “great-souled.” At its core, it describes someone who acts with generosity, compassion, and a noble perspective—even in adversity. When you label a person as magnanimous, you don’t just praise them—you frame their behavior as a moral benchmark, someone who rises beyond pettiness, pride, or selfishness.
But here’s what’s often overlooked: using this word doesn’t merely reflect virtue—it reinforces it. It’s not just that a magnanimous act changes behavior; it transforms how we perceive and value moral character in others.
